The Testaments: A Thrilling Sequel to The Handmaid's Tale (2026)

Get ready for a chilling thrill ride as we dive into the world of 'The Testaments', the highly anticipated sequel series to the Emmy-winning adaptation of Margaret Atwood's 'The Handmaid's Tale'. This coming-of-age thriller promises to take us on a terrifying journey, exploring the lives of young women growing up in the oppressive regime of Gilead.

In a world where colors hold immense significance, we meet Agnes, played by the talented Chase Infiniti. As a 'Plum', Agnes is coming of age under the watchful eye of a totalitarian regime, training to become a Gilead wife. The trailer, set to the iconic 'Dreams' by The Cranberries, showcases a dark and disturbing reality. Agnes' initial naivety gives way to a growing awareness of the horrors around her, as we witness familiar images of Gilead's patriarchal rule, including public executions and the strict enforcement of laws by the Wives.

But amidst the darkness, there is a glimmer of hope. Agnes and her fellow Plums vow to fight back, inspired by the resistance and the unwavering spirit of their mothers. It's a powerful moment that showcases the resilience and determination of these young women, who are determined to change their fate.

'The Testaments' is an adaptation of Atwood's sequel novel, brought to life by the original showrunner and executive producers of 'The Handmaid's Tale'. With a star-studded cast, including the Emmy-winning Ann Dowd reprising her role as Aunt Lydia, this series promises to continue the legacy of its predecessor.

Set four years after the events of 'The Handmaid's Tale', the perspective shifts to the young women of Gilead, who have known nothing but this oppressive world. Executive producer Warren Littlefield hints at a complex portrayal, stating, "It's not all ugly." He further emphasizes the importance of Aunt Lydia's school, which educates these young women, and the role of Ann Dowd in carrying the narrative forward.

Showrunner Bruce Miller adds an intriguing layer, mentioning "adolescent wives" and the dynamic between girls facing the looming threat of forced marriages. This exploration of adolescence under Gilead's rule is sure to be a captivating and thought-provoking element of the series.

The official logline describes 'The Testaments' as an evolution of 'The Handmaid's Tale', focusing on the dramatic coming-of-age stories of Agnes and Daisy, two young teens navigating the brutal and divine-justified world of Aunt Lydia's preparatory school.

Premiering on April 8th with three episodes, 'The Testaments' will release new installments weekly on Hulu and Hulu on Disney+ for bundle subscribers.
